Type of DoorDescriptionDouble DoorStandard French door style with two hinged doors that open outside.Sliding French DoorsOffer a modern twist with doors that slide open instead of swinging.French Patio DoorsDesigned specifically for patio access, frequently featuring wider frames.Bi-Fold DoorsA series of panels that fold back, producing a large opening.Single French DoorsOne door option, ideal for smaller sized areas or as a secondary entry.Custom Size French DoorsTailored dimensions to fit special openings and architectural styles.Products for Custom French DoorsThe product chosen for custom French doors plays a substantial role in visual appeals, durability, and maintenance. Here are some common materials:
MaterialProsConsWoodTimeless look, excellent insulation, adjustable finishes.Requires regular upkeep (painting/staining).FiberglassLong lasting, energy-efficient, low maintenance.Greater preliminary cost compared to wood.VinylCost effective, low upkeep, great energy performance.Minimal color and design options.AluminumLightweight, very little maintenance, modern look.Poor insulation homes unless thermal break is used.Installation ConsiderationsInstalling custom French doors needs cautious preparation and factor to consider to ensure a seamless fit and operation. Here are some bottom lines to think about during installation:
Professional Installation: Hiring a certified contractor is often advised to make sure doors are set up properly and efficiently.
Measurements: Precise measurements of the door opening are essential. This ensures that the doors fit completely and work correctly.
Design Matching: The design of the custom French doors should complement the total architectural style of the home.
Energy Efficiency: Consider energy-efficient choices, such as double or triple pane glass, to improve insulation.
Hardware Selection: Choose quality hardware that matches the door design and guarantees longevity.
1. Just how much do custom French doors cost?
The cost of custom French doors can differ widely based upon products, size, and extra functions. Typically, prices can vary from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000 or more, including installation.
2. How long does it take to get custom French doors?
The preparation for custom French doors can take anywhere from 4 to 12 weeks, depending on the producer and intricacy of the design.
3. Can I install custom French doors myself?
While it is possible for a knowledgeable DIYer to install custom French doors, professional installation is recommended to ensure proper fitting and performance.
4. Are custom French doors energy effective?
Yes! Lots of manufacturers provide energy-efficient options, including insulated frames and low-emissivity glass, which can help in reducing energy costs.
5. What upkeep do custom French doors need?
Upkeep depends upon the product. Wooden doors might require routine staining or sealing, while fiberglass and vinyl doors normally require very little maintenance, such as cleaning with soap and water.
